Teresa Ernster

Teresa Ernster van der Stoep (born 10 June 1970) is a Dutch female weightlifter, competing in the 69 kg category and representing Netherlands at international competitions.[2] She competed at world championships, most recently at the 2001 World Weightlifting Championships.[3] Ernster was a judoka and undertook weightlifting as part of cross-training.[4]

Personal

Teresa is married to Henk van der Stoep, a Greco-Roman wrestler and ten-time Dutch national champion. His sister, Yvonne van der Stoep is also a weightlifter and masters world champion.[4][5]
